Hi,
I have a report that calls a form in a loop.
The form is for writing the content of report lines.
That works fine.... But now I want a cancel button on that form,
that should cancel the form and the report.
If I set variable that I check for cancel the loop the report ignores it
and runs the loop til the end.
How can I cancel the loop or how can I close the report after
setting the variable with the cancel button?
Does anyone have an idea?
Regards,
Red

Hi
This should work:If ReportName.Run = action::cancel then CurrReport.Quit;
Regards0 -
Isn't it easier to call the report from the form and not the form from the report?0
